    Tanknology, a United Uptime Services Company, a fast-growing leader in the petroleum services industry, is looking for experienced, energetic, hardworking Operations Manager, you will receive on-the-job training to gain a comprehensive understanding of fuel management for facilities with above and below-ground storage systems. This role involves learning about the equipment, documentation, and procedures necessary for conducting inspections.

    What You Will Do:

    Responsibilities will include establishing business plans, developing marketplace opportunities, overseeing internal processes, and providing employee leadership in the achievement of common goals.
